Yes. Look at the Product Details on the book page. If it's got a File Size (with optional Print Length), then it'll be Mobi. If it's only got a Print Length, that means Topaz.
Also, you can download the sample and open it up with either Kindle for PC/Mac to see if it's got the funky fonts, or with a text editor to see if it's got TPZ0 as the first four characters of the file.
Topaz are in fact strippable, but it's a hassle to convert them properly as you lose bold and italics and such and have to re-enter that sort of formatting manually.
